WebThe C N bond energy in nitrobenzene is about 62 kcal/mol while the homolytic cleavage of phenyl nitrite into NO and phenoxy radicals is only 23.7 kcal/mol. For this reason, the isomerization of the nitro group (NO 2) into nitrite (ONO) followed by nitrite decomposition has been considered a viable reaction path. However, the formation of ...
